版權聲明
首發自微信公共帳號: iNotes;
轉載請注明作者。
恩,,出一個教大家用雙拼的教程,練練手(練習如何出寫一個好的教程)。
1. 大部分人平時打字的樣子
如果我們要打一個字,下面都以打『將』、『茍』這兩個字為例。
平時我們打字的時候是這樣的:
將
- 輸入 jiang
全拼-將.png
- 按下空格鍵或 1 鍵
茍
- 輸入 gou :
茍-1.png
- 按下 。鍵或 PageDown 鍵
-
按下 2 鍵
茍-2.png
這種輸入方式,也是大部分人輸入的方式。它的名字叫:
全拼。
2. 更好的輸入方式
一直這么輸入,有人就不爽了:
英文要輸入morning這個單詞,就要依次按下 m-o-r-n-i-n-g ( 把 - 作為每兩次按鍵之間的間隔符,下文同),也就是要按7次鍵(不考慮單詞聯想的情況下)
英語必須一個一個按鍵,這是英語,沒辦法。但漢語不是這樣的。我們漢語的最小單元并不是一個個的字母。而是一個個的聲母和韻母。就像下面這張表一樣。
即我們的最小單位,是聲母和韻母。那么,讓一個鍵代表 g(用 g 鍵,本來就一個字母的就沒必要改?。粋€鍵代表 uo(比如用 o鍵) ,『國』字就能打出來了(當然還要繼續翻頁和選詞,但此時效果已經和按下g-u-o是一樣的了);一個鍵代表 j(比如就用 j 鍵),一個鍵代表 iang(比如就用 l 鍵),『將』 字就能打出來了(當然也還要繼續翻頁和選詞)。
既然『國』和『將』能按兩個鍵打出來(然后選)。那我們就能同樣的,所有的漢字都用兩個鍵打出來(然后選)。
然后我們需要做的就是兩個工作:
- 決定用哪些單鍵來代表那些多個字母的聲母或韻母(甚至其組合,比如 iang)。
- 即,決定具體、到底哪個鍵代表uo,哪個代表iang,哪個代表ui。。
- 記住上面的設置。
當然了,第一部的鍵位設計并不用我們做。
已經有很多人設計好了。
是的,你應該想到了:
有的人覺得用 o 代表 uo 舒服或按著方便,有人覺得還是用 i 來代表 uo效率更高。
所以最后不同幫派的人設計出了不同的方案。
比如包括
- 小鶴雙拼
- 智能ABC
- 紫光雙拼
- 搜狗雙拼
- 自然碼
- 等等還有一堆。。
現在你知道了,不同的方案,就是有的用 o 代表 uo,有的卻用i代表,不過如此。
那么,**選哪個呢? **
我們等一等再說。
3. 進階的輸入方式
雖然用 g-o 代替g-u-o來打『國』,能少按一個鍵;用 j-h 代替j-i-a-n-g來打『將』。但實際上你遇到的是會這種情況:
將.png
雖然少按了鍵,已經比全拼好很多了;但也還是要看著選詞啊,有的詞還是要翻頁,更有的詞還要翻好幾頁,最后,,還有一種詞,你翻了好幾頁,就得往前翻,因為可能翻過了。。。;最后的最后,你翻了好幾頁,沒找到,覺得翻過了,就往前翻,回頭翻到第一頁,然后把第一頁仔細又查了兩遍,可還是沒找到,這時候你就知道,你可能是兩次都翻過了,,人生啊。
有沒有一種辦法來解決這種問題?我能不能不看著屏幕找來找去,選來選去,能不能閉著眼睛把這字給打了?能不能真正地盲打?
ps:
- 首先,大部分人說的盲打只是不看鍵盤而已;
- 其次,認為自己能不看鍵盤盲打的,遇到一些單字的時候(不能用智能輸入法直接匹配詞語的時候),選詞的時候還是要按12345的。。
- 恩,這種『盲打』太弱了好么,,
- 這里要說的是真正的盲打,指的是鍵盤和屏幕都不看的那種,沒有候選框(就是輸入完拼音讓你繼續用12345選詞的那個長框)。
可以可以,但是有這種輸入法嗎:
當然有!
- 真正的盲打是這樣一種場景:比如你看著書在電腦筆記軟件上記筆記,你只需要看著書就好了;再比我現在在寫作,其實可以閉著眼睛來寫作的(很爽的。。)(雖然我為了不在睜開眼睛之后發現因為一個空格之類的錯誤白打了半天,還是不會長時間這么干的。。)
- 當然,上面那句一般是用來裝逼的(雖然基本也不怎么會錯),實際情況是,還是要屏幕隔一小段時間瞅一下有沒有明顯的錯誤就好了(比如打完一句話、一個片段的詞)。
- 這就好像是,雖然對自己的編程能力很放心,但是為了后面不至于全寫完了再測試變得特別麻煩,我們選擇周期性地進行增量式調試。(每次寫一點,看看對不對)
所謂的打字,其實無非就是編碼嘛,如果你按個 j ,待選的詞就是『見、經、剿、就、奇』這種,如果你繼續按下 jiang 或 jl,就成了『將、僵、獎』這種了。
所以思路也很明顯,我們再加鍵唄!
多按一些鍵,我們就能更好的定位出我們要的那個『將』了。
加到多少呢?
4個足夠了。(為什么是4,就不要操心了先)
即:
- 如果一個輸入法的設計良好的話, 任何一個字,我們最多按四下鍵,就能把這個字唯一地打出來。
- 沒錯,既然能唯一地打出來,那就不用選字了,這就是真正的盲打了。
所以我們在打漢字的時候,這種設計良好以至于能盲打的輸入法到底有哪些呢?
下面就揭曉一下這種輸入法:
五筆輸入法!
沒錯,五筆可能大多數人知道但是沒學過沒練過。但它的確很強大,經過練習打字會很快,而且,能真的盲打。
五筆是一種完全的形碼,以筆畫和字形對某個字進行編碼,4步之內奪你,,不對4碼之內,唯一定位一個常見字。
恩,,不調皮了,今天的主角肯定不是五筆。。。
下面請出我們金光閃閃的大boss:
小鶴雙拼(前面我介紹的雙拼方案的一種,只是那時候我們不知道它就是大boss,就像那些年我們錯過的。。)
小鶴雙拼在前面雙拼的基礎上,再加兩個鍵。加的方式就是加入首尾(按筆畫順序)的筆畫、部首、小字,首一個,尾一個,如此的兩鍵。
比如國這個字,先輸入了 g-o,代表全拼的g-u-o,然后 k 代表『口』,y 代表『玉』,當輸入完g-o-k-y之后,神奇的事情(其實一點都不神奇)就發生了:你現在按下空格就好了,『國』字就這么直接打出來了,再也不需要選詞
而且我們可以設置輸入法的一個『四碼上屏』的功能,說的是:因為4個碼可以唯一定位一個常用字(有的按鍵組合也可能按下了四個鍵還不唯一,但這種極少,幾乎可以忽略,熟練了以后就能輕易記?。?,所以我們可以讓輸入法軟件在輸入四碼之后,不按空格,直接把字打出來(或者可以認為輸入法幫你按了一下空格)。
所以小鶴雙拼,一共四碼/鍵,前兩個是音碼(全拼的簡化),后兩個是形碼(用來繼續縮小字的范圍直到唯一【極少情況的唯二也是完全可以接受的】)。
大 boss 的原理介紹完畢,就這么簡單,真沒別的了。
4. 選擇、練習和配置
選擇
在第 2 部分挖了坑,『我們該選哪種雙拼方案』,現在填一下這個坑:
- 我用小鶴且只用過小鶴。
- 如果你想實現真正的盲打,而且不學五筆的話,只有小鶴可以。(所以如果這個東西,對你有吸引力的話【我就是】,不用選了,直接來小鶴就好)。而且你也可以只學小鶴雙拼的音碼作為普通的雙拼,日后再學形碼進階。
- 其他的方案,我沒用過,不好評說,可自行谷歌,聽聽『各種主流雙拼都用過的人』他們是怎么說的。
練習
好了,我們假設你選擇了小鶴雙拼,現在就給一個練習的方法。
注:這里給出的方法是音碼和形碼都有,如果你選的是其他的方案(別的方案只有音碼),道理是一樣的,自己搜索資源,照著我的音碼套路練就好了。
一、 音碼的練習
首先聲明
我不是針對誰,網上的什么口訣啊之類的,,都是垃圾。
這個東西就要肌肉記憶的,比如我現在打字就不用想哪個鍵在哪個位置,寫作的時候,就只需要思考自己要寫的東西就好了。
現在提供給你一個2小時左右就能開始用雙拼打字的練習方案,說起來簡單得你不敢信。
你應該這么練:
- 首先,去這個網址,下載這個小鶴雙拼的音碼部分的鍵位練習工具,這個工具其實也利用了 active recall記憶原理,是極佳的入門工具,誰用誰知道:
http://ys-k.ys168.com/116124359/VHSOjhs3J3J1T7652O68/%E5%8F%8C%E6%8B%BC%E9%94%AE%E4%BD%8D%E7%BB%83%E4%B9%A0.rar
然后用這個工具,練習一到兩個小時。 -
把這個圖存到你電腦里,以便查看,或者干脆打印一份出來
小鶴雙拼-音碼.png -
把你的輸入法設置成這樣:
小鶴雙拼-練習.png
這樣,開始練習兩個小時左右,你就可以開始正keng常keng使ba用ba雙拼打liao字mei了。但是不用擔心,坑坑巴巴是很正常的,但大概幾天或一周左右就能恢復或超越全拼的速度了。
二、 形碼的練習
只有小鶴雙拼有這部分的練習,選擇其他方案的同學,此 2 可略過。
如果你還沒練習音碼部分,這里也先略過吧。
- 到這里下載『小鶴雙拼飛揚版』(它是小鶴雙拼的官方自家出的輸入法軟件,就像搜狗一樣)http://flypy.ys168.com/
- 安裝完,切換到這個輸入法之后,任何輸入界面下,按下『orm』,然后『空格』,就能調出
閱讀我框住的那部分。
里面講的就是具體怎么加后面那兩個形碼鍵的。。。不過如此。
練習的過程:
- 看完框里的『拆分規則』、『筆畫部件字根』、『小字字根』
- 利用學到的規則,把『拆分例字』里的字自己打著看看,整明白它們。
- 兩個小時以后,去正常使liao用mei吧。
軟件的配置
電腦端的配置
- 只用音碼
在你的輸入法軟件里-屬性-勾選使用雙拼-選擇雙拼方案,完。 - 音碼和形碼都用
- 第一種,下載『小鶴雙拼飛揚版』官方輸入法就好了。
* 這里再繼續給一進階的配置哈:等你練習得比較熟練以后,就可以使用下面這個裝逼配置了:
* 這樣的效果是,你打字的時候屏幕是這個樣子的(比如你要打『杉』這個字→_→),屏幕上看起來是這個樣子的。
* 不明就里的觀mei眾zhi可能就會問:『恩?等等,你怎么打的,怎么都沒有那個選擇框啊』。。。但其實你知道,這都很簡單么。千萬別覺得學了個這東西就多了不起,它只是一個非常容易學,但是大多數人都不知道,哪怕知道也不愿意花時間練的這么一門一勞永逸的技能啊。
- 第二種,不用官方的輸入法,而是用百度、搜狗、qq輸入法這種智能拼音輸入法,來掛接個性短語(這個個性短語指的是,比如當你按下g-o-k-y的時候就把『國』字提前到候選框的前面的位置【比如提到第一個】)。這種的話,只是在音碼的基礎上,用形碼作為輔助碼。但是不能四碼自動上屏,只是在候選詞太多的時候,用形碼幫你縮小一下范圍。需要的話可以自行百度配置,原理其實就是『自定義短語』。
手機端的配置
- 音碼的配置(安卓、iphone都可以)
百度輸入法,設置里,勾選雙拼就好了。
- 音碼+形碼(安卓端適配比較好,下面只針對安卓,iphone用戶的話,官方沒有提供,可自行折騰,比較麻煩)
- 輔助碼配置:http://flypy.ys168.com/ 去官網下載相關文件進行配置。
小鶴雙拼-百度.png
* 核心文件是下面四個,按照readme.txt 把后面三個文件配置到百度輸入法就好了。
* 鍵位的話,我現在用的是17鍵的效果是這樣的:
- 官方軟件『Android系統:小鶴音形7.2-1_同文版』:http://www.flypy.com/down.html
我的配置歷程:
- 先是qq輸入法的音形雙拼配置
- 然后是『小鶴雙拼飛揚版』
- 然后是安卓版的配置
- 一開始覺得全鍵誤觸太高,就用了14鍵
- 后來覺得重碼率太高(就是你按完鍵還需要選的無關候選詞太多),就轉17鍵,這個轉換過程非常得。。。難受。但我也轉了,難受了大概一天吧。
- 今天繼續寫此文的時候,剛剛才注意到原來官方不知道什么時候出了一版安卓版的,所以就用唄,超級好用!但是唯一的不足是它是全鍵的,但跟鶴友交流發現,大家用全鍵盤的誤觸率好像并不高? 恩,那我今天開始也用一下全鍵嘍。
這個教程居然寫了幾乎一整天。。基本上是我所有文章里耗時top3了(碼字本身并不特別費時間。。)
想到自己看過的那么多各種編程教程,作者們想想也都是非常不容易。
另外,這個教程剛寫出來,之后會根據大家的反饋,繼續完善更新。
歡迎反饋。
iNotes